TOKYO GODFATHERS (2003) presented by Cicada Cinema

The late, great Satoshi Kon’s penultimate animated feature film takes place on Christmas Eve, when three homeless Tokyo residents discover an abandoned newborn baby. As they try to solve the mystery of the lost child and the fate of her parents, they confront their own pasts and face their futures, together. Co-written by Keiko Nobumoto (COWBOY BEBOP), and featuring a new dubbed English audio track. Cicada Cinema promises to have some holiday surprises to make the night an extra jolly one for everybody.

NAVIGATING THE HOLIDAYS WITHOUT STRESS AND WORRY

For many people the holidays are a time of year that, rather than being joyful, give rise to additional stress and worry. In addition to family expectations, time pressure, and financial worries, this year there may be concerns over traveling and mixing with others as well.

Buddha, 2,600 years ago, provided teachings on overcoming stress and worry that are as relevant today as they were during his time. In this workshop, participants will learn how to see that it is often our responses to events, and not the events themselves that cause us stress and worry. We may not be able to change what appears to us, but we can definitely learn to change  our reaction to them from negative to positive.

Practical instructions will be provided to help participants transform the common causes of holiday stress and worry into positive experiences such as patience, giving, patience, and recognizing the kindness of others – all of which will give rise to happiness for oneself and others.

The Art of Tea: Herbal Tea Blending Workshop

In this class, you will be exploring the diverse flavor profiles of different types of tea leaves, herbs and flowers and learn how to identify different flavor notes and aromas. In addition, you will learn how to handle these different components of tea to craft a custom blend to suit your own personal tastes and preferences.

Tea Blending involves working with a wide variety of herbs, flowers, roots, fruits and spices in addition to tea, which allows for endless flavor explorations and possibilities when it comes to blending. This class will encourage you to explore a variety of flavors and aromas and find ones that resonate with you. There will be tasting sessions during the workshop and you will get to make several different blends of your very own to take home!

The local kitchenware shop Goods for Cooks will be providing tools for the workshop and Blossom & The Bee Tea Company for providing many of the herbs from their garden.

Intro to Hand Lettering Workshop

In this two hour class, Dylan will share the first steps of hand lettering and teach you how to concept, design, and letter phrases for any use—cards, posters, t-shirts, or anything else you might think of! Bring a short phrase (3-5 words) to practice with. Participants will receive their own tombow marker, pencil, and worksheet during the class and to take home. Materials provided by local art store Griffy’s Art Supply.

Lettering is an umbrella term that covers the art of drawing letters, instead of simply writing them. Lettering is an art form where each letter in a phrase or quote acts as an illustration. Each letter is created with attention to detail and has a unique role within a composition.
